Runbook fragment — inbound antique clock (repair)

Item: longcase clock from the Quillbury estate, crated, fragile. Carrier: Marrow & Sons Freight. Receive at dock 2 only. Keep upright; pendulum is packed separately inside. Photograph crate condition before signing. No unboxing until the restorer arrives. Courier hand-over proceeds per the confidential instruction below.

dispatch memo: the eliok quenok courier leaves the sorael aldath belion tammir casix gileth queniel jorath ledger at gate 9299 under passcode 897989

Subject: Handover — Larkspan API release 7.4

Handing over the 7.4 release of the Larkspan public REST API. Main change is cursor-based pagination replacing offset pagination on the `/records` endpoints; the compatibility shim stays until 8.0. Reviewer notes are in the release branch. Artifacts are built and staged; please verify them against the deploy key below.

deploy key for kajof-fajop: bky6_gDHw9Q

Scope: the Tallypipe metrics-aggregation sidecar running beside the Corvid API pods. Use break-glass only when dashboards are blind for more than fifteen minutes and the sidecar refuses its normal credential refresh. Steps: confirm blindness in the Ridgeline console, notify the duty manager, open the emergency vault, restart the sidecar with the fallback key, then rotate everything within one hour. All access is logged and reviewed next business day. Support staff: do not improvise. The emergency recovery passphrase appears directly below.

strongbox words: holdor-lamius-gileth

**Vendor note: Inkmill markdown pipeline**

Rendering for Parchway docs is outsourced to Inkmill under an annual contract, renewing each March. They handle sanitization and PDF export; we own the upload queue. SLA: 4-hour response on rendering failures. Escalate only after two failed retries. Their support desk is reachable at the address below.

billing contact of hahaf-baguf = zorael.tammir.jorius@sivrelhq.internal

Subject: Quickstore 4.2 — bloom filter now fronts the KV layer

Plugin authors: starting with this release, Quickstore places a bloom filter ahead of the key-value store. Negative lookups return faster; false positives fall through safely. No API changes are required on your side. Verify your plugin against the staging build referenced below.

session token of fahif-tadup = htk3_9c7